Detailed Description
The technical solutions in the embodiments of the present invention will be clearly and completely described below with reference to the dr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only a part of the embodiments of the present invention, and not all of the embodiments.
In the description of the present invention, it is to be understood that the terms "upper", "lower", "front", "rear", "left", "right", "top", "bottom", "inner", "outer", and the like, indicate orientations or positional relationships based on the orientations or positional relationships shown in the drawings, are merely for convenience in describing the present invention and simplifying the description, and do not indicate or imply that the device or element being referred to must have a particular orientation, be constructed and operated in a particular orientation, and thus, should not be construed as limiting the present invention.
Referring to fig. 1-2, a vinegar spraying mechanism with a filtering structure, which comprises a bottom plate 1 and a charging barrel 2, wherein two L-shaped plates 3 are symmetrically and fixedly arranged on the upper surface of the bottom plate 1, a first mounting plate 4 is fixedly arranged between the two L-shaped plates 3, a through hole is formed in the first mounting plate 4, the charging barrel 2 is fixedly arranged in the through hole, a first annular plate 5 is fixedly arranged in the upper end of the charging barrel 2, a sleeve 6 is fixedly arranged between the two L-shaped plates 3, a second annular plate 7 is fixedly arranged in the lower end of the sleeve 6, a filter plate 8 is arranged between the first annular plate 5 and the second annular plate 7 in a clamping manner, a second mounting plate 22 is fixedly arranged on the lower surface of the bottom plate 1, a driving mechanism is fixedly arranged on the rear side wall of the second mounting plate 22, and the charging barrel 2 is fixedly connected with the driving mechanism through a connecting mechanism.
The driving mechanism comprises a motor 9, a worm wheel 11, a worm 12, a winding wheel 13, a rotating rod 14 and two fixing plates 15, the two fixing plates 15 are symmetrically and fixedly arranged on the rear side wall of the second mounting plate 22, rod walls at two ends of the worm 12 are respectively and rotatably connected with the corresponding side wall of the fixing plate 15 through first bearings, the worm wheel 11 is fixedly sleeved with the rod wall of the rotating rod 14, the rod wall of the rotating rod 14 is rotatably connected with the rear side wall of the second mounting plate 22 through second bearings, the worm wheel 11 is meshed with the worm 12, the motor 9 is fixedly arranged on the left side wall of the fixing plate 15 at the left side, the left end of the worm 12 penetrates through the fixing plate 15 at the left side and is fixedly connected with the output end of the motor 9, and the front end of the rotating rod 14 penetrates through the second mounting plate 22 and is fixedly sleeved with the winding wheel 13.
Coupling mechanism includes two sets of first U-shaped plates 16 and two second U-shaped plates 17, every first U-shaped plate 16 of group all is provided with two, every first U-shaped plate 16 of group is symmetrical fixed respectively and is set up in the one side that two L-shaped plates 3 carried on the back mutually, and inside rotates respectively and is provided with first leading wheel 18, the bar mouth has been seted up respectively to the upper end inside of two L-shaped plates 3, two second U-shaped plates 17 symmetry are fixed to be set up in the lower surface of bottom plate 1 and inside respectively rotates and is provided with second leading wheel 19, the upper end both sides of feed cylinder 2 are fixed respectively and are provided with haulage rope 20, the other end of two haulage ropes 20 is respectively through the bar mouth that corresponds, first leading wheel 18 and second leading wheel 19 and winding wheel 13 fixed connection, be convenient for can realize the lift of feed cylinder 2 when actuating mechanism works.
The upper and lower surfaces of the filter plate 8 are respectively fixedly provided with a sealing gasket, so that the filtering effect of the filter plate 8 is ensured.
The left side and the right side of the lower surface of the bottom plate 1 are respectively and symmetrically and fixedly provided with the first supporting feet 21, so that the driving mechanism is convenient to install, and the stability of the whole device is ensured.
A discharge pipe 10 is fixedly arranged inside the right side plate at the lower end of the charging barrel 2.
In the utility model, vinegar is guided into the sleeve 6 during vinegar pouring, filtered by the filter plate 8, flows into the material cylinder 2 and is led out through the discharge pipe 10, when the filter plate 8 needs to be cleaned, the motor 9 is started to rotate in the positive direction, the output end of the motor 9 drives the worm 12 to rotate, the worm 12 drives the worm wheel 11 to rotate, the worm wheel 11 drives the rotating rod 14 to rotate while rotating, the rotating rod 14 drives the winding wheel 13 to rotate while rotating, the winding wheel 13 winds the two traction ropes 20 while rotating, the material cylinder 2 moves downwards by the self gravity to facilitate the disassembly and cleaning of the filter plate 8, after the cleaning is finished, the filter plate 8 is placed on the upper surface of the first annular plate 5, the motor 9 is started to rotate in the negative direction, the winding wheel 13 winds the two traction ropes 20, and then the material cylinder 2 moves upwards and is extruded with the filter plate 8 through the second annular plate 7, ensuring the filtering effect.
